Overview of AI Terminal Assistants
AI terminal assistants represent an innovative class of software, revolutionizing the usability of command interfaces. These tools leverage natural language processing (NLP) to interpret and act on user inputs, streamlining many standard terminal operations.

Features Provided by AI Terminal Assistants
Prominent functionalities of AI terminal assistants encompass:
- Natural Language Interpretation (NLI): These assistants excel in comprehending and responding to commands in everyday language, enabling users to communicate in simple English instead of mastering intricate command syntax.
- Situational Recognition: AI terminal assistants possess the ability to consider the current terminal status and past user commands when crafting responses, enhancing their usefulness and efficiency.
- Assisted Command Entry: These tools offer suggestions for completing commands as the user types, aiding in time-saving and reducing typographical errors.
- Error Rectification: They also have the capability to fix typing and grammatical mistakes in commands, ensuring accurate execution of commands.

AI Terminal Assistants Risks
AI terminal assistance, despite its numerous advantages, also comes with certain risks and challenges that users should be mindful of:
- Dependency and Overreliance: Users may become overly dependent on AI terminal assistants for completing tasks, which could lead to a lack of proficiency in manual command-line operations. Overreliance on these tools might hinder the development of essential skills needed to troubleshoot or manage systems without AI assistance.
- Security Vulnerabilities: AI terminal assistants, if compromised or manipulated, pose security risks. They often require access permissions to execute commands, potentially creating a vulnerability if accessed by unauthorized individuals or if the AI itself becomes compromised.
- Privacy Concerns: Usage of AI terminal assistants involves sharing data and commands with the assistant for interpretation and action. This exchange of information raises privacy concerns, especially if sensitive or confidential data is inadvertently shared or stored insecurely.
- Misinterpretation and Errors: Despite advancements in natural language processing, AI terminal assistants may misinterpret commands or make errors in execution, especially in complex or ambiguous instructions. This can lead to unintended consequences, data loss, or system errors.
- Ethical Implications: AI terminal assistants, if not developed or trained with proper ethical guidelines, may exhibit biases or unethical behavior in decision-making. This can result in unfair treatment or discrimination based on the input commands or historical data.
- Limited Understanding of Context: While AI terminal assistants aim to understand the context of commands and previous interactions, they might still struggle with nuanced or evolving contexts, leading to inaccurate responses or actions.
- Integration Challenges: Integrating AI terminal assistants with existing systems or applications might pose challenges, including compatibility issues, disruptions in workflow, or complexities in setup and maintenance.
- Technical Limitations: AI terminal assistants, despite their advancements, still have limitations in understanding highly specialized or domain-specific commands. This might restrict their usability in certain technical fields or industries.
- Unintended Consequences of Automation: The automation provided by AI terminal assistants can lead to unintended consequences, such as executing irreversible commands or automating processes without thorough oversight, potentially causing system disruptions or errors.
